More intimidation from Coillte at Nowen Hill, West Cork.

category cork | crime and justice | news report author Sunday February 11, 2007 18:44author by WE Report this post to the editors

Yet again, more intimidation bullying , and trespass from Coillte at Nowen Hill, Dunmanway, Co. Cork.
road_obstruction1.jpg

On 09/08/06, I fenced off the boundry between my lands and Coillte lands, on instructions from my Solicitor. My Solicitor then outlined the position ,and what I had done , to Coillte's Solicitors on 18/08/06.

The boundry was installed by me in accordance with specific measurements from Coillte's own Planner, Mr. Joe Sinnot ( which measurements I have on a map from Mr. Sinnott, dated 1990 ).

On 26/10/06, I visited my land at Nowen, and found that a large mound of stones and earth was placed across a roadway on my land, blocking access. At 7.00 pm that evening, I reported the matter to Garda, Ian O Callaghan, at Dunmanway Garda Station.
He recorded what I told him under Pulse No: 3564652.

On 29/11/06, on another site visit to my land at Nowen Hill, I met a Coillte contractor, who informed me that Mr. Richard Delahunty, Coillte Forester, instructed him ( contractor) to place an obstruction of turf and " big stones" across my private roadway, in my land. ( see photo), despite the fact that my Solicitor had informed Coillte's Solicitors on 18/08/06, that I had fenced off the property, using Coillte's own measurements !.

On 26/01/07, I made a full statement of these events to Garda Ian O Callaghan, Garda Station, Dunmanway, Co. Cork.
He informed me that this matter will be fully investigated.

In conclusion.
These criminal acts by Coillte are just not acceptable. What is happening at Nowen Hill at Coillte's hands must stop.

As far as I am concerned, Coillte have broken many FSC principles on Nowen Hill, and must be brought to task for their actions. Despite Coillte having been informed by my Solicitor of the situation, they carried out this dispicable act, without even contacting me.

I had to go to Nowen today to the leased Coillte area.

On arrival, I found a Coillte contractor, in my land, increasing the height of an earthen/stone mound which Coillte had already placed across a roadway , on my land. ( previously reported to you).

Last Tuesday, I was talking to Richard Delahunty, local forester about this. I told him that I had a map of the boundry, supplied by their own Planner in 1990, and that I requested a meeting with Coillte on site to confirm all this. I was more than surprised today to find that Coillte were once again in my land, and raising the hight of the offending obstacle, without even contacting me. Please see photos of myself sitting in front of the machine trying to stop them from placing further soil/stones in my way. Also is photo of local forester, Mr. Jim O Connor, ( blue jacket), supervising works.

These latest acts by Coillte are the last straw. Myself and the farmer whom Coillte will not give access to his land , managed to halt the digger, and are refusing to let it be taken off my land, until Coillte finalise all outstanding issues on Nowen Hill.

It is absolutely terrible that we have to take these measures in order to protect our rights.

On Tuesday 27th March, while I was on my site at Nowen, I telephoned Mr Delahunty, Coillte Forester, and informed him that Coillte had no authority to come onto my Leased area from Coillte, and carry out any ground works.
However, on Tuesday night, 27/03/07, Coillte instructed their contractor, Mike Casey, to come onto the site, under the cover of darkness, and carry out the illegal roadworks. ( see attachments ). Coillte also instructed their contractor that it was up to him to go onto my private land and remove, physically, a digger machine which we had held there until Coillte had sorted out this problem. The contractor also removed this machine, under the cover of darkness, on Tuesday night last.

On Wednesday, 28/03/07, I was again on Nowen, and noticed the damage Coillte had done. I contacted my Solicitor about this, who informed me that Coillte had no right to do what they did, and that they were also in breach of Planning laws. I informed my Solicitor that I was going to reinstate the damaged land, which I did. I then informed Mr. Delahunty, Coillte Forester that I had reinstated the land, and instructed him to tell Coillte that they had no authority to come onto the leased land to carry out works.

Again, I reiterate, that this matter is now very serious. If Coillte contractors are continually instructed to hinder my access, and also to carry out excavation works on my leased site, I am fearful that a conflict situation might arise, resulting in health and safety of peronnell being breached.

Last week, Woodmark made public, their surveillance report on Coillte. Because of Coillte's inadequate dispute reolution procedure, a major CAR ( Corrective Action Requirement ), was issued against Coillte, in relation to the ongoing disputes local people have with Coillte at Nowen Hill, Dunmanway, Co. Cork.

Despite the audit findings, Coillte are still ignoring Woodmark, and are continuing their actions against individuals at Nowen Hill, who have legal rights.
